Tomcat最新版本深度解析,功能特性与性能提升

Tomcat最新版本深度解析,功能特性与性能提升

森久 2024-12-21 公司产品 657 次浏览 0个评论
摘要:,,Tomcat最新版本的功能与特性深度解析。该版本在性能和安全性方面进行了优化提升,具备更高的可扩展性和稳定性。新增多种功能和工具,如动态资源加载、智能负载均衡及高效缓存机制等,有效提升了Web应用程序的开发效率和运行性能。该版本还注重用户体验,简化了安装和配置流程,降低了维护成本。Tomcat最新版本为企业级Web应用提供了强大的支持和保障。

Tomcat最新版本概述

最新版本的Tomcat在性能、安全性以及功能等方面都带来了许多重要的更新和改进,这个版本不仅优化了线程管理、网络传输和垃圾回收等核心组件,还增强了云集成、微服务支持和开发者工具集成等特性,使得开发、部署和管理更加便捷。

新增功能

1、更好的云集成:支持更多的云服务和容器化部署场景,使Tomcat在云计算环境下运行更加高效。

2、性能优化

线程管理:优化线程池和并发处理机制,提高并发处理能力。

网络传输:优化网络协议栈和缓冲区管理,降低延迟,提高吞吐量和稳定性。

* 集成新的垃圾回收策略,减少垃圾回收的频率和耗时,提高运行效率。

3、安全性提升

* 增强身份验证功能,支持多种身份验证方式。

* 提供更细粒度的权限控制,支持基于角色和用户的访问控制。

* 支持更多的安全通信协议,如HTTPS、TLS、SSL等,确保数据的安全传输。

Tomcat最新版本深度解析,功能特性与性能提升

4、微服务支持:提供对微服务架构的支持,包括服务发现、负载均衡和API管理等。

5、开发者工具集成:集成热部署、远程调试和自动部署等开发者工具,提高开发效率和便捷性。

性能优化详解

1、线程管理优化:通过调整线程池的大小和参数,以及引入新的并发处理机制,提高系统的并发处理能力。

2、网络性能改进:优化网络协议栈的实现,减少数据传输的延迟和丢包率,通过智能缓冲区管理,提高系统的吞吐能力。

3、垃圾回收优化:针对Java的垃圾回收问题,引入新的垃圾回收策略,减少垃圾回收的耗时,提高系统的运行效率,通过调整内存分配策略,减少内存泄漏的风险。

安全性提升详解

1、增强的身份验证:除了传统的用户名密码验证方式,还支持OAuth、LDAP等高级身份验证方式,加强密码管理,采用更强的密码加密和存储机制。

2、细粒度的授权管理:提供基于角色和用户的访问控制,确保只有授权的用户才能访问特定的资源,还提供审计和日志功能,方便对系统访问进行监控和管理。

3、加密通信:强制使用HTTPS、TLS等安全通信协议,确保数据在传输过程中的安全,加强对证书的管理和验证,防止中间人攻击。

Tomcat的最新版本在性能、安全性和功能等方面都带来了显著的改进,通过了解和掌握这些特性和优势,读者可以更好地使用和管理Tomcat,满足日益增长的业务需求和性能优化要求,随着技术的不断发展,我们期待Tomcat在未来能够带来更多的创新和突破。

转载请注明来自山东万福庄严城乡发展集团有限公司,本文标题:《Tomcat最新版本深度解析,功能特性与性能提升》

百度分享代码,如果开启HTTPS请参考李洋个人博客

发表评论

快捷回复:

评论列表 (暂无评论,657人围观)参与讨论

还没有评论,来说两句吧...

Top